MERSİN - HDK Co-spokesperson Ali Kenanoğlu called for support for the "1 million signatures for peace" campaign.

Reactions against the appointment of trustees to the municipality in Akdeniz district of Mersin continue on the 8th day. Peoples' Democratic Congress (HDK) Co-spokesperson Ali Kenanoğlu, Green Left Party Co-spokesperson Ahmet Asena, Democratic Alevi Associations (DAD) Co-Chair Zeynel Kete, Peoples' Equality and Democracy Party (DEM Party) MPs Öznur Bartın, Mahmut Dindar, Perihan Koca and Ali Bozan and civil society organizations made a statement in front of the municipality building under police blockade.
 
DEM Party Mersin Provincial co-chair Bedriye Kuş read the messages of Nuriye Aslan and Hoşyar Sarıyıldız, co-mayors of Akdeniz Municipality, who were appointed trustees and arrested, to applause and cheers.
 
'OUR STRUGGLE WILL CONTINUE'
 
The message of the co-chairs reads as follows: "The failure of the opposition to take a strong enough stance against the trustee lawlessness in the past has paved the way for the narrowing of the circle of democracy today. The trustee coup is a matter of the struggle of the entire opposition and the people for freedom and democracy. Silence against this unlawfulness means being a partner in the oppression of the government. We call on all segments who believe in justice to wage a common struggle against this injustice. We reject any attempt to legitimise the trustee system. We believe that neither the elected people of Mersin nor the people of Mersin will ever accept the trustee system. For 9.5 months, we have been serving Mersin and Akdeniz together, and we invite everyone who is in favour of justice, especially the elected officials of the city, to take a clear stance against the trustee. Finally, we would like to say the following words with conviction from Tarsus Prison; We will continue to struggle for a fairer, freer future together. Our voice, which is tried to be silenced today, will be the loud voice of millions tomorrow. We believe in this and we increase our struggle under all circumstances.
 
With love, solidarity and resistance... Hoşyar Sarıyıldız, Nuriye Arslan. Co-Mayors of Akdeniz Municipality."
 
'WE WILL DEFEND'
 
HDK Co-spokesperson Ali Kenanoğlu noted that the trustee mentality has turned into a form of governance and said, "The people buried the government in the ballot box by winning the municipality despite the government's threat of trustee system. They called on the opposition to speak up against the trustee system. However, when it happened to them, they realised that trustee system is a form of governance. In order to spread its own lies, the governemnt first silences Free Press and creates its own media, trying to 'make the public accept the lie'. We will continue to defend peace and truth in these lands."
 
Referring to the İmralı talks, Kenanoğlu said, "We will always be the defenders of honourable peace in these lands, of a democratic and negotiated peaceful solution to the Kurdish problem. We continued to call for peace even in the worst conflict processes. We did our best to build this process. Since 1 October, those who sabotaged this process are precisely those who appointed trustees to Akdeniz Municipality. It is this trustee mentality that dynamites peace."
 
Stating that peace cannot be left solely to the initiative of the government, Kenanoğlu said, "We have started a '1 million signatures for peace' campaign. We will continue to defend coexistence in Akdeniz, in Mersin and in the whole geography of Turkey, in the common homeland. We will defend it despite them. Because they are gone, we are here to stay."
